Two metallic plates of equal thicknesses and thermal conductivities K1 and K2 are put together face to face and a common plate is constructed, figure. The equivalent thermal conductivity will be:


- \(\frac{\mathrm{K}_{1} \mathrm{~K}_{2}}{\mathrm{~K}_{1}+\mathrm{K}_{2}}\)
- \(\frac{2 \mathrm{~K}_{1} \mathrm{~K}_{2}}{\mathrm{~K}_{1}+\mathrm{K}_{2}}\)
- \(\frac{\mathrm{K}_{1}+\mathrm{K}_{2}}{2}\)
- \[\frac{\left(K_{1}^{2}+K_{2}^{2}\right)^{3 / 2}}{2 K_{1} K_{2}}\]
Answer
(B) 2 ~K _ 1 ~K _ 2 ~K _ 1 + K _ 2
